It's official: Gallup school wins national makeover contest

Posted at: 10/29/2012 11:08 AM
By: Tracy Dingmann, KOB.com

It's official - and now some kids in Gallup are celebrating big news.

Jefferson Elementary School was just named the winner of a national contest - and the first prize is a makeover of the school.

Glidden Paint sponsored the Glidden Colorful Classrooms contest, in which people could vote online for their favorite schools to win the prize.

Jefferson dominated the voting after being named to the top five last week.

The school will now get 200 gallons of fresh paint - along with painters to help get the job done.
